Summary
Indonesia Tuang is a specialty Arabica coffee from the Manggarai region of Flores, Indonesia, produced by local small farmers in collaboration with Tuang Coffee. The variety is Kartika, grown at 1400-1700 meters above sea level. The coffee undergoes anaerobic dry processing: cherries are checked upon arrival, fermented in plastic bags in a dark room, then dried on raised beds with regular turning for 6-8 weeks. Flavour notes include plum jam, dark chocolate and candy.
